Park
Olalla Reservoir Park lot and ramp off Olalla Rd about three miles north of Hwy 20. Georgia-Pacific timberland open dawn to dusk.
Walk in
Short from the park lot. Bank between the dam and the ramp.
Wading
Bank and small boat. Banks drop off.
Usual window
Stocked trout; surplus Siletz steelhead some winters. Confirm ODFW.
